sublime安装与配置

Sublime是个很强大的编辑器,支持跨平台、多语言代码高亮、高可扩展性,也是目前比较流行的一款代码编辑器。

一、安装Package Control

sublime使用Package Control进行插件管理。
Package Control 安装方法如下:使用快捷键 ctrl+~,打开console窗口

console

对于版本2而言,复制下面代码到console,回车;

import urllib2,os;pf='Package Control.sublime-package';ipp=sublime.installed_packages_path();os.makedirs(ipp) if not os.path.exists(ipp) else None;open(os.path.join(ipp,pf),'wb').write(urllib2.urlopen('http://sublime.wbond.net/'+pf.replace(' ','%20')).read()) 

对于版本3而言:复制下面代码到console,回车;

import urllib.request,os;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); open(os.path.join(ipp, pf), 'wb').write(urllib.request.urlopen( 'http://sublime.wbond.net/' + pf.replace(' ','%20')).read())

import

稍加等待,就会成功,重启生效。在sublime的工具栏 preferences->package control 一项,代表安装成功。sublime的插件就可以通过它进行安装了。

注意:
如果对于ST3上述方法无效,那么就下载安装包https://sublime.wbond.net/Package%20Control.sublime-package,并放到C:\Users\Administrator.SC-201605271916\AppData\Roaming\Sublime Text 3\Installed Packages,类似这样的一个路径下,重启ST3即可。
打开preference,就能看到Package Control选项。

二、安装插件

使用快捷键ctrl+shift+p打开package control面板,输入Package Control: install Package 回车,稍等在打开的输入框中输入Emmet,然后安装即可。

这里写图片描述

安装完成及实现效果,如下图所示:

installed

输入div.col-md-10*10,按ctrl+E 或者 tab,效果如下图:

Emmet

三、常用插件

sublime比较常用的插件还有很多,比如以下常用的几种:
sublimeLinter 代码检测插件
Bracket Highlighter 行内语法检测插件
SublimeCodeIntel 代码高亮插件
Dayle Rees 颜色主题
JSLint js代码质量检测工具
Git 版本控制系统
SideBar Enhancements 侧边栏增强
DocBlockr phpdoc风格注释

安装方法类似,不再赘述。

四、遇到的问题

1.pyV8问题
在安装的过程中,会遇到pyV8 library加载失败以及There are no packages available for installation等问题,导致安装失败,那么就需要手动处理了。

对于pyV8 library加载失败,解决方法为:
打开C:\Users\Administrator\AppData\Roaming\Sublime Text 3\Installed Packages,新建pyV8文件夹,然后到https://github.com/emmetio/pyv8-binaries/blob/master/README.md上下载系统对应的库文件,解压并放在新建的文件夹下即可,重启sublime Text 3即可。

2.无可用安装包问题
对于There are no packages available for installation问题,是IPv6造成,如果我们的Intent服务提供者(ISP)不支持IPv6就会引发上述错误,原文如下:

This error is happened with IPv6 problem. If yourInternet Service Provider (ISP) does not support for IPv6 you got this error.

解决方法是,获取sublime.wbond.net的ipv4地址,并加入到本地hosts文件中即可。获取方法如下:

ipv4

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值